Welcome to Financial Mastery Simplified, the podcast that turns the complex world of money into easy-to-understand lessons. Imagine sitting down to your favorite snack, a simple yet delightful peanut butter and jelly sandwich. That's the ease and satisfaction we aim to bring to your financial education journey. Each episode, hosted by a team with deep roots in the mortgage sector and a passion for simplification, peels back the layers of financial topics that touch every aspect of your life. From mortgages to investments, budgeting to saving, we dive deep, making the intricate world of finance accessible to everyone. Jacqueline "Jax" Crider, our guiding light, brings over 20 years of mortgage industry experience to the table, blending her wealth of knowledge with a keen desire to empower and educate. Whether you're a first-time homebuyer, looking to refine your investment strategy, or simply aiming to understand the financial decisions affecting your daily life, this podcast is your go-to resource. With Financial Mastery Simplified, we're not just sharing information; we're building a community where financial empowerment is the goal, ensuring that you're equipped to make sound decisions for a secure future. Join us as we demystify finance, one topic at a time, making each episode as enjoyable and straightforward as making a PB&J sandwich. Welcome to clarity, welcome to empowerment, welcome to Financial Mastery Simplified.

    The Money Lessons We Never Learned in School

    In this episode of Financial Mastery Simplified, Jax Crider and Paris discuss the critical role of mindset in achieving financial success. They emphasize the importance of intentionality in financial decisions, the impact of money on relationships, and the necessity of surrounding oneself with positive influences. The conversation explores how understanding money as a tool can help individuals overcome challenges and build wealth, while also addressing the societal pressures that often lead to poor financial choices. The episode concludes with actionable advice on finding money in one's budget and the significance of community and education in financial literacy.

    Master Money by Mastering THIS First (Hint: It’s Not Budgeting)

    In this episode of Financial Mastery Simplified, host Jax Crider and financial expert PJ Vescovi delve into the complexities of financial health, exploring the emotional, spiritual, and practical aspects of money management. They discuss the importance of intentionality in financial decisions, the impact of generational wealth and poverty mindsets, and the intersection of religion and money. PJ shares insights from his book, 'The Great Money Reform,' emphasizing the need for a healthy relationship with money and practical strategies for achieving financial well-being. The conversation also highlights the significance of teaching financial literacy to children and making sound financial decisions based on self-awareness and emotional intelligence.

    Passion or Paycheck? Why Most Careers Get It Wrong

    In this episode, Jax Crider discusses the intersection of financial stress and career choices, particularly in low-paying fields like veterinary medicine. The conversation emphasizes the importance of side hustles, understanding debt to income ratios, and challenging traditional educational paths. Jax encourages listeners to think critically about their financial decisions and explore alternative career options that may lead to greater fulfillment and financial stability. In this conversation, Jax Crider discusses the evolving landscape of career opportunities and financial independence. She emphasizes the importance of aligning one's passions with career choices and explores innovative approaches to achieving financial success. Jax shares personal experiences and insights on how to utilize resources effectively, the significance of mindset in financial planning, and the necessity of choosing paths that resonate with individual life goals.
